I'm back and I missed my cutiepie P2 so, so much! My cousin complained that P2 was sleeping all the time and that she couldn't play with him though I already told her about hamsters being fond of pulling an all nighter. She also did some changes in P2's cages. P2 has a metal wheel with bumble feet causing spaces (it's the only kind of wheel large enough for a syrian that I can get here in my country) which I put and weaved paper into so it will be safer. They changed the paper with another one covered with letterings and drawings and crayons and ink, and I almost lost my mind. At first, I really thought it was sweet of my cousin and her mother to do that that I forgot ink can be dangerous to hamsters when swallowed. It's a relief though that P2 hasn't chewed yet on the parts with ink.

P2 has also become more friendly than ever! I can not believe it! He must have been really well taken cared of by my lovely cousin while I was away (which makes me question my way of handling him in some way lol). When I went to get him, he was awake to welcome me back and indeed it felt like he did welcome me back. I greet him with my unusual excited high pitched voice, which he recognized and responded with those curious little eyes looking my way. Then I put my hand inside his cage which he sniffed and sniffed and sniffed all the way! My uncle and I chtchatted, my hand still in his open top bin cage while he continued sniffing. I think he missed me.

We got back home, which is literally just next door my cousin's. I noticed P2 was a bit stressed with another change of environment as he was biting and digging furiously so I gave him a treat and left him. I checked up on him again after some time and he's now peacefully sleeping out in the open in his favorite corner.

Home sweet home to the both of us!
